So, I did a BIG roller fender at rear fender.
With the XXR 9" ET25 I had problems @ trackdays;
Now that the fender roller is done, i can use the car lower in trackdays with the XXR 9" et25.
Unfortunately i dont have pics of the fender roll job.
But looking this tracks pictures, i think its ok =]
About the 9.5". i get with a friend one set of ENKEI PF01 9.5" et35, its was ok, nice fitment and nice brake cleareance.
The new problem is that I bought a BBK!!
Front: AP Racing Pro5000+ 378mm
Rear: AP Racing Pro5000+ 316mm
The front set diameter is about 422mm (disc + calipers) and my wheel have a inside diameter of 430mm without steps.
Now, i have to get the BBK in and look any modifications, like spacers.....
Than, when the BBK its ok, i will take again a set of TE37 9.5" ET22, i can get with a friend.
Im still very undecided about the offset:
- +22 - Concave look, an i think the wheel get very outside
- +35 - "perfect fitment", but i will lose the concave look.
At least, i decided the TE model: TE37 SL Black Edition II
